How much do field service technician part time j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for field service technician part time in the United States is $24.71,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$28.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Field Service Technician Part Time do?

A Field Service Technician Part Time is responsible for installing, maintaining, and repairing equipment or systems at customer locations, but works fewer hours than a full-time technician. They often travel to different sites to diagnose issues, perform routine maintenance, and ensure equipment functions correctly. This role typically requires technical skills, problem-solving abilities, and good customer service, as the technician interacts directly with clients. Part-time positions offer more flexible schedules, making them ideal for those seeking work-life balance or supplemental income.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Field Service Technician Part Time,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Field Service Technician Part Time, you need strong technical troubleshooting abilities, mechanical aptitude, and a high school diploma or relevant technical certification. Familiarity with diagnostic tools, service management software, and manufacturer-specific equipment is typically required. Excellent customer service, time management, and communication skills help you effectively interact with clients and manage tasks independently. These skills and qualities ensure timely and efficient repairs, high customer satisfaction, and reliable field operations.

What are some common challenges faced by a Field Service Technician working part-time, and how can they be managed?

Part-time Field Service Technicians often face challenges related to scheduling flexibility and managing multiple service calls within limited working hours. Balancing customer expectations while adhering to a part-time schedule requires strong communication and organizational skills. Additionally, staying updated on technical knowledge and company procedures, despite fewer hours on the job, is essential. Proactively coordinating with dispatch and other technicians, as well as making use of digital resources for ongoing learning, can help manage these challenges effectively.

Job description

Position Summary:

OPEX Corporation is currently looking for a part time Field Service Technician. This position will require the employee to be flexible with their hours. Due to customer demands, the employee may be required to work occasional weekends. The worker will have a high exposure level to customer service as they will be responsible for visiting our current clients to help solve their technical issues.

Responsibilities:

  • This position is responsible for the day to day maintenance, troubleshooting and repair of mail opening, document scanning and/or material handling equipment
  • Installing and setting up new equipment
  • Interact with the customer to determine the problem
  • Completing field service reports
  • Keeping the customer informed as repairs are made and answer any question that may arise.
  • Interact with management as well as other personnel to analyze and correct any equipment performance issues.
  • Completing and submitting weekly online timecards and expense report

Qualifications:

  • Associate's Degree in Electronics and/or equivalent hands-on job experience.
  • Must have excellent customer service skills.
  • Possessing a driver's license, insurance and a reliable vehicle.
  • Ability to lift at least 25 pounds independently.
  • Ability to maneuver a job site, including small spaces in around our equipment.

Physical/Work Environment: 

  • Due to our large variety of clients worker could potentially conduct work in an office or warehouse environment
  • Commuting for an extended period of time throughout duration of shift
  • Must have the ability to lift heavy machine parts while on duty
  • Ability to maneuver a job site, including small spaces in around our equipment
  • Squatting, bending, kneeling, reaching overhead, reaching forward will occur while on the job
